Understanding Pump-and-Dump Scams:

Before evaluating aelf specifically, it is crucial to understand the nature of pump-and-dump scams. These schemes typically involve a group of individuals artificially inflating the price of a cryptocurrency through coordinated buying and promotion. Once the price reaches a desired level, the scammers sell off their holdings, leaving unsuspecting investors with significant losses.
